WebTip 1: leave the little plastic backing on iron patches when sewing the iron on patch onto your fabric. Tip 2: If you are having trouble sewing through the glue layer you might want to try a wedge needle over a regular needle. It should penetrate the glue layer easier than other needles. WebDec 17, 2024 · Trim around the hole to make it square, snip around 1/4-inch in each corner, press your turned edges under then cut a matching square match out of a similar fabric that is 1/2-inch bigger. Place the patch underneath the hole then secure it with some pins, stitch around the outsides either using a straight stitch or a zig-zag stitch.
